    Music Performance: Piano

    About

    Piano majors at McGill are trained in all aspects of a professional career, with a focus on the solo repertoire requirements for undergraduate exams. You will take courses in performance, music theory and history, musicianship, professional training, and more.

    The program offers many performance opportunities within and outside of the school: weekly Piano Tuesday recitals in our small hall, regular student soloist concerts in the larger halls, studio classes, public studio recitals, two annual concerto competitions, and visiting master classes.

    Bologna-signatory countries

    McGill welcomes qualified applicants from throughout Europe, including from schools in Bologna signatory countries. Applicants will be considered for admission into McGill degree programs of similar duration as those at comparable, research-intensive universities in Europe. Accordingly, qualified applicants to the faculties of Arts, Education, and Management at McGill, with a Bologna-compliant diploma that leads to a three-year undergraduate program in Europe, will be admissible to a three-year program at McGill. Students in Management will be required to complete additional mathematics coursework.

    Career

    The Piano program is aimed to help you to pursue a career in performance. However, your courses in music theory, history, professional skills and diction will allow you to pursue many different career paths after graduation. You can even choose to pursue performance while holding other jobs related to music.

    You could become a professional:

    • Performer
    • Songwriter
    • Music theorist
    • Music journalist
    • Producer
